Abstract:
      The cassava starch was modified by coupling agent,and the influence of type and addition level of coupling agent on the properties of cassava starch/NR latex vulcanized film were investigated.The results showed that,the physical properties of vulcanized film were the best when the coupling agent Si69 was used,and the optimum addition level of coupling agent Si69 was 0.6 phr.It was indicated by DMA that the tanδ and glass transition temperature of the modified cassava starch filled vulcanized film were decreased,and the low temperature performance was improved.It was proved by SEM that,the dispersion of starch in NR latex and the bonding behavior between starch and rubber were improved when the coupling agent was used.
